Intro and history: Genpact is a global professional services firm that was established in 1997 as a business unit within General Electric. The company was spun off into an independent entity in 2005. Genpact has grown significantly since its inception, with operations in over 25 countries and a diverse workforce of more than 90,000 employees. Industry: Genpact operates in the Business Process Outsourcing (BPO) and Information Technology Services industry.
Product, Services and Operations: Genpact provides a wide range of services including finance and accounting, procurement and supply chain, risk and compliance, customer experience, and digital innovation. The company also offers industry-specific services in areas such as banking and financial services, insurance, manufacturing, life sciences, and healthcare.
Funding Details: As a publicly-traded company, Genpact is funded through equity and debt financing. As of 2020, the company's market capitalization was approximately $7.2 billion.
Acquisitions: Genpact has made several notable acquisitions over the years, including Headstrong in 2011, Rage Frameworks in 2017, and Rightpoint in 2019.
Awards and Achievements: Genpact has received numerous awards and recognitions for its services and workplace culture, including being named a Leader in the Gartner Magic Quadrant for Finance and Accounting BPO for several consecutive years. The company has also been recognized as a 'Best Employer' by AON Hewitt multiple times.
